Impact of Security Breach on Neobank’s Cryptocurrency
Overview of the Incident
A recent security breach has significantly impacted a neobank’s cryptocurrency, leading to a drastic decline in its value. The digital currency, known as AVICI token, experienced a precipitous drop of 49% from its highest value within 24 hours. This plunge set a new record low for the token, although it later recovered slightly from these losses.
